タイトル : DOMでXMLをUTF-8Nで保存する方法 投稿日 : 2005/06/21(Tue) 16:28 投稿者 : くぅた
[OSのVer]:Windows XP [VBのVer]:VB.NET はじめて投稿させていただきます。 現在、VB.NETでXML文書を読み込み、編集して保存するクライアントシステムを構築しようとしていま す。XMLは、DOMで操作しています。 読み込み→編集→保存、まではうまくできたのですが、元のXMLファイルは文字コードがUTF-8のBOMな しで保存されており、(UTF-8Nというらしいんですが・・・)VBで変換して保存したものはBOMがつい たUTF-8として保存されてしまいます。 他のWebシステムで使うXMLファイルなので、BOM付きに変わってしまうとそのシステムでは読み込みが できなくなってしまうようです。 文字コードについて、Web上でいろいろと調べたのですが、UTF-8NでXML文書を保存する方法、または UTF-8をUTF-8NにVBで変換する方法が見つからず、困っています。 どなたか、ご存知でしたらご教授いただけたら、と思います。よろしくお願いいたします。 |